Made catfish (and oven fries and turnip greens) for dinner, with my family's traditional trashy tartar sauce. It's just three parts mayo, one part sweet relish, but as long as I live, that will be "real" tartar sauce to me. Also made homemade cocktail sauce from ketchup, horseradish, and lemon juice. Way yummy. Trashy food rocks.
